RETURN OF CULTIVATIONS AND LIVE STOCK IN THE PROVINCE OF OTAGO, NEW ZEALAND—DECEMBER, 1854.
| Districts. | Number of Acres under different kinds of Crop, &c. | | | | | | | | | Amount of Stock. | | | | | | Nature and average quantity of Produce per acre. | | | | | | | | Nature of Produce, and Price sterling. | | | | | | | | Enumerators. |
|---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- |
| | Wheat. | Oats. | Barley. | Potatoes. | Turnips. | Fallow. | Hay, Pasturage, &c. | Gardens. | Penced, but not cultivated. | Total number of acres in crop. | Number of acres of uncultivated Land. | Horses. | Horned Cattle. | Sheep. | Goats. | Wheat. | Oats. | Barley. | Potatoes. | Turnips. | Hay. | Wheat. | Oats. | Barley. | Potatoes. | Turnips. | Hay. | Pasture. | Wool. | Rye Grass. | Fruit Trees and Bushes. | |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| bush | bush | bush | tons. | tons. | | per bush. s. d. | per bush. s. d. | per bush. s. d. | per ton. s. d. | per ton. s. d. | per acre. s. d. | per acre. £ | per bale. £ | per acre. £ | value £ | |
| South of Popotunoa—Popotunoa to Clutha River—Inch Clutha—and north bank of Clutha River | 54 | 51 | .. | 40 | .. | .. | 7 | .. | .. | 991 | 16564 | 49 | 1296 | 11300 | 17 | 36.8 | 69 | .. | 10½ | .. | .. | 9 4 | 5 0 | 5 0 | 8 | 40 0 | .. | .. | 13 | .. | .. | Mr. Samuel Shaw |
| Tokomairiro. | 108 | 24½ | .. | 19¼ | .. | 118½ | 32 | .. | 323½ | 2794 | 6524 | 25 | 690 | 9750 | .. | 30.4 | 34 | 40 | 8 | 10 | .. | 10 0 | 5 0 | 5 0 | 7 | 15 0 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. John Cargill |
| Waihola | 22½ | 2 | .. | 6 | .. | .. | 61 | .. | .. | 62½ | 11844 | 11 | 130 | 1868 | 45 | 30 | 30 | .. | 9¾ | .. | .. | 10 0 | 5 0 | 5 0 | 7 | 15 0 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. John Cargill |
| Native Village, &c. | 18¾ | 1¾ | .. | 14¼ | .. | .. | 37 | .. | .. | 42¾ | 459½ | 31 | 379 | 650 | .. | 26.6 | 36¾ | .. | 6 | .. | .. | 12 0 | 5 6 | 8 0 | 8 0 | 15 0 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. George Shand |
| West Taieri | 152½ | 47 | 1 | 18¼ | 8 | 42 | 50 | 21 | .. | 263¾ | 12791 | 29 | 749 | 9600 | 12 | 29.8 | 34½ | 50 | 6¼ | 13¼ | .. | 12 0 | 5 6 | 8 0 | 7 | 15 0 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. George Shand |
| East Taieri | 121 | 62½ | 1 | 14 | 49 | 111½ | 78½ | 11 | .. | 256 | 11121 | 21 | 474 | 70 | .. | 40 | 37.3 | 25.4 | 6½ | 28 | .. | 12 0 | 5 6 | 8 0 | 7 | 15 0 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. George Shand |
| Green Island, The Porbury, Caversham, &c. | 140¼ | 221½ | 3½ | 29 | 111½ | 49 | 119¼ | 4½ | .. | 544½ | .. | 38 | 530 | .. | .. | 38.4 | 38.6 | 29.3 | .. | .. | .. | 9 0 | 4 6 | 6 6 | 7 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. David Howden |
| Anderson’s Bay and east side of Harbour.. | 88½ | 17¾ | 14¼ | 9¾ | 9¾ | 9¾ | 28 | 10 | .. | 243¾ | .. | 8 | 165 | 188 | .. | 31.8 | 27 | 48 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| 130 | Mr. James E. Brown |
| Wakari | 33½ | 106¾ | 1 | 20½ | 34 | 54 | 36¼ | 4 | 22¾ | 258 | 320 | 17 | 401 | 1000 | 2 | 39 | 36.8 | 41.6 | 8 | 6¼ | .. | 12 0 | 5 0 | 5 0 | 7 | .. | .. | 3 | .. | 9 | .. | Mr. R. Hood |
| North-east Valley. | 62 | 105¾ | 14 | 29¼ | 54 | .. | 14 | .. | 8 | 40 | 656 | 7 | 205 | .. | .. | 22 | 39 | 19 | 60 | 6¼ |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| 2 | .. | .. | .. | Mr. William Smith |
| Dunedin and Town Belt | 2½ | 2½ | ½ | 7¼ |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| 14 | 31 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. John Shepherd |
| Port Chalmers, Portobello, Otago, Purakaunui, and Blueskin | 81½ | 25 | .. | 35½ | .. | .. | 34¼ | 4½ | .. | 158½ | .. | 25 | 347 | 1004 | 68 | 30¾ | 32½ | .. | .. | .. | .. | 12 0 | 5 0 | .. | 7 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. William Mills |
| Waikouaiti. | 147¼ | 121 | .. | 17¼ | .. | .. | 320 | 6 | .. | 605¼ | 3584 | 98 | 589 | 5800 | 80 | 49 | 50 | .. | 6.2 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. Daniel M’Nicol |
| Goodwood, &c., to Waitangi River | 44 | 13¼ | .. | 10½ | .. | .. | 6 | .. | .. | 74¾ | 2024 | 62 | 6511 | 17677 | 5 | 32.8 | 32 | .. | 7.9 |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| .. | Mr. Daniel M’Nicol |
| | 1077 | 728½ | 5½ | 276¼ | 37½ | 743 | 711¼ | 52 | 331¼ | 3168 | 15878¼ | 435 | 6511 | 58902 | 251 | 32. | 37.¼ | 7½ | | | | | | | | | | | | | | |
